Job Description

Position Overview

The A Level Biology Teacher is responsible for delivering an engaging, rigorous, and student-centred Biology curriculum to secondary students preparing for international qualifications. The successful candidate will inspire a passion for biological sciences, foster critical thinking and scientific inquiry, and support students in achieving outstanding academic outcomes while contributing to the wider life of a dynamic bilingual school community.

Key Responsibilities
Teaching and Learning
Plan, deliver, and evaluate high-quality Biology lessons for A Level students in accordance with the school's curriculum and examination board requirements (Cambridge International, Pearson Edexcel, or equivalent).
Prepare students effectively for external examinations through well-structured teaching, practical investigations, and regular assessment.
Develop students' understanding of biological concepts through inquiry-based learning, experimentation, data analysis, and independent research.
Deliver engaging laboratory practicals while ensuring all health and safety procedures are followed.
Differentiate teaching to meet the needs of students with a range of abilities and learning styles.
Integrate technology and innovative teaching strategies to enhance learning outcomes.
Promote scientific literacy,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ills.
Assessment and Reporting
Design and administer formative and summative assessments aligned with curriculum standards.
Monitor student progress using assessment data to inform teaching and provide targeted support.
Maintain accurate records of student achievement and attendance.
Provide timely, constructive feedback to students and communicate progress effectively with parents and school leadership.
Prepare detailed academic reports in accordance with school policies.

Person Specification
Essential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Biology, Biological Sciences, Life Sciences, or a closely related discipline.
Recognised teaching qualification (PGCE, QTS, teaching licence, or equivalent).
Strong subject knowledge across molecular biology, genetics, ecology, physiology, evolution, and practical laboratory techniques.
Essential Experience
Experience teaching A Level Biology or an equivalent international curriculum.
Proven ability to prepare students successfully for external examinations.
Experience delivering practical laboratory lessons safely and effectively.
Experience teaching in an international or bilingual school is desirable.
Knowledge and Skills
Excellent understanding of A Level Biology specifications and assessment objectives.
